Mifen Prince Noodle House 花溪王

Mifen Prince Noodle House is the most authentic GuiZhou Rice Noodle House (Mifen) in Houston. They serve classic noodle dishes like beef noodle soup with rich and flavorful broth.

One highly recommended soup restaurant is Pho Binh, which serves up delicious bowls of pho that are sure to warm you up on a chilly day. Locals rave about the quality of the broth and the fresh ingredients used in each bowl. Prices are very reasonable, with most bowls priced between $8-10.

Another favorite among locals is the Soup Man. This small restaurant offers a variety of soups, including hearty options like chicken noodle and chili, as well as more exotic choices like lobster bisque and Thai coconut curry. Prices are also very reasonable, with most soups priced between $5-7.

For those looking for vegan or vegetarian options, Green Vegetarian Cuisine has a variety of delicious soups made with plant-based ingredients. Their lentil soup is particularly popular among both locals and tourists. Prices are slightly higher than some other options on this list, with most soups priced between $10-12.
